Deadpool Premium Pinball Machine Released by Stern in August 2018, Deadpool doesn’t take itself seriously — and that’s the whole point. Lead designer George Gomez built a table around Marvel’s foul-mouthed anti-hero that’s less “epic superhero battle” and more “unhinged comedy sketch with a pinball attached.” Nolan North reprises his role as the voice of Deadpool, cracking jokes at your expense every time you drain a ball, and Zombie Yeti’s artwork gives the whole cabinet a loud, comic-panel energy that’s impossible to miss on an arcade floor.
The Deadpool Premium Pinball Machine model is the one collectors actually want. Where the base Pro model keeps things simple, Premium adds eight extra drop targets, a motorized disco ball that lights up mid-game, custom molded Wolverine and Dazzler figures, and — genuinely — a chimichanga food truck that doubles as a time machine. It’s ridiculous. It’s also one of the more replayable comic-themed tables Stern has put out in the last decade.

Why the Deadpool Premium Pinball Machine beats the Pro
Three things you don’t get on the base model:
- A three-bank drop target guarding a molded Lil’ Deadpool bash toy — knock it down enough and you unlock a shot at the target itself, which talks back to you.
- An actuated up/down ramp that feeds the right flipper — this is the shot that makes repeat games feel different every time, since the ramp physically changes position.
- The motorized disco ball. There’s no strategic reason for it. It’s just there because Deadpool would want it there.
Both ramps are stainless steel with a wireform Katana Sword return, and the sound comes through a 3-channel amplifier with separate bass and treble — loud enough that you’ll hear Deadpool’s commentary clearly even in a crowded game room. Premium owners also get the “Deadpool’s Mix Tape” cassette, 11 original tracks with Zombie Yeti sleeve art, more of a collector’s item than something you’ll actually play in a cassette deck.
Who actually enjoys this Deadpool Premium Pinball Machine
Reviewers on Pinside consistently point out the same thing: the shots feel good, the callouts are genuinely funny even after a hundred plays, and the disco ball plus molded figures make it stand out next to Stern’s more serious-toned games (Guardians of the Galaxy, Avengers). If you’ve read the comics, you might wish they’d worked in characters like Weasel or Blind Al — but as a standalone game, it holds up.
This is a good fit for: Marvel/Deadpool fans who want humor over gravitas, players who like a table that rewards repeat play instead of punishing beginners, and anyone tired of every superhero pinball table taking itself too seriously.

Is this the Pro, Premium, or Limited Edition?
This listing is the Deadpool Premium Pinball Machine model — the middle tier. It adds the disco ball, extra drop targets, molded Wolverine/Dazzler figures, and the chimichanga time machine toy that the base Pro model doesn’t include, without the collector pricing of the 500-unit Limited Edition.
Who’s the voice of Deadpool on this Deadpool Premium Pinball Machine?
Nolan North, who also voices Deadpool in Marvel’s video games, recorded original dialogue specifically for this pinball table.
Is the disco ball actually part of gameplay, or just decoration?
It’s motorized and lights up in sync with certain modes — mostly for atmosphere, but it’s a genuine mechanical feature, not just a sticker.
